+template <typename Point>
+inline typename coordinate_type<Point>::type vec_length_sqr(Point const& pt)
+{
+ return dot_product(pt, pt);
+}
+
+template <typename Point>
+inline typename coordinate_type<Point>::type vec_length(Point const& pt)
+{
+ // NOTE: hypot() could be used instead of sqrt()
+ return math::sqrt(dot_product(pt, pt));
+}
+
+template <typename Point>
+inline bool vec_normalize(Point & pt, typename coordinate_type<Point>::type & len)
+{
+ typedef typename coordinate_type<Point>::type coord_t;
+
+ coord_t const c0 = 0;
+ len = vec_length(pt);
+
+ if (math::equals(len, c0))
+ {
+ return false;
+ }
+
+ divide_value(pt, len);
+ return true;
+}
+
+template <typename Point>
+inline bool vec_normalize(Point & pt)
+{
+ typedef typename coordinate_type<Point>::type coord_t;
+ coord_t len;
+ return vec_normalize(pt, len);
+}
